If you are already tuned for it...the rest is easy. Flip yer air box over,remomove the componant from the middle,use a simple twist action.Now reach in and pull out that plastic flapper valve.Doesn't matter if you destroy it getting it out,it is no longer needed. Now plug the hole.I used a peice of plastic cut to fit. I used the lid from a rattle can,the more flexible type,less brittle,easier to cut. Then put hi-temp silicone around the diameter of the hole,stick in plug,let dry. Dont forget to plug the rubber hose that once led to the componant(the flapper actuater).

Small Box Mod Done.

if you want a true small airbox mod, you also cut out the floor of the airbox under the air filter, all the way to the lip that the air filter rests on.

The jury is still out.
I have seen die hard land speed guys say that it hurt them.
I did some testing years ago and it showed a gain.
I can't remember the exact numbers, so i'll addlib.......
First pass was from second gear at 60mph, going thru the gears between 2 signs{on a closed course, ofcourse;)}. The signs were about 9/10ths of a mile apart.
I went 182mph on the GPS.
Went back in 6th gear at about 100mph and rolled the throttle for the same distance.
Went I think 183mph.
Went home, did the small box mod and went back 2 hours later. Did the same 2 passes, and went 3mph faster on both.
The bike was a stock 2000 model with Yosh bolt on mufflers only.
